Note:

Although the SB-14 operates with maximum light output at the S

position, be sure to set the camera's shutter speed dial at slower than the

ordinary synchronization speed. For example, if the camera's synchro­

nization speed is 1/125 sec., set the shutter speed at 1/60 sec. orslower.

At the M (Manual) Position

Set the SU-2 to the M setting and the SB-14 operates

manually at its maximum light output regardless of the

flash-to-subject distance. In this case, you have to calcu­

late the exposure manually by referring to the exposure

calculator dial.

Detaching the Sensor Unit

To detach the SU-2, push in the two protrusions at the

base of the sensor and pull it out.
